Definitions
Core meanings and parts of speech for titan.
noun
a person of exceptional importance and reputation
See also: colossus, behemoth, giant, heavyweight
noun
(Greek mythology) any of the primordial giant gods who ruled the Earth until overthrown by Zeus; the Titans were offspring of Uranus (Heaven) and Gaea (Earth)
See also: Titan
noun
the largest of the satellites of Saturn; has a hazy nitrogen atmosphere
See also: Titan
